Knowing This Condition Identification Processes in The Land Down Under

Securing an correct ADHD assessment in Australia can be a lengthy journey. The typical process usually starts with a referral from your general practitioner, which might follow concerns raised by parents, educators, or the individual themselves. This referral then directs you to a specialist – often a developmental pediatrician or clinical psychologist - who possesses the experience and training to conduct a thorough evaluation. The assessment frequently includes interviews with family members, school reports, behavioural checklists, and sometimes neuropsychological testing to rule out other conditions and gain a comprehensive picture of cognitive function. It's crucial to remember that there are varying levels of expertise among providers, so finding a specialist familiar with the diagnostic criteria outlined in the DSM-5 is highly recommended for an successful review.
